Parish Council News - August 2012

There was no Parish Council meeting in August but the next meeting is on 20th September.

Following the recent floods, meetings have been held, on site, between some of our Councillors, residents and representatives from the authorities concerned such as NWater, Northumberland County Council and the Environment Agency. Progress appears to have been made for Dene Garth area with local landowners agreeing to carry out some recommendations made by the environment agency.

Work is to be started soon on addressing some of the untidy areas of the village such as strimming back brambles etc at the top of Horsley Road and by Piper Road and also repairing fencing by North Meadows and Sunningdale Bungalow area. The Churchyard also needs tidying up and ivy removed from the walls.
